The Essence of 18-Gauge: Precision in Every Nail

Understanding Gauge in Brad Nails

  1. Gauge Demystified: The term "18-gauge" refers to the thickness or diameter of the nail. In the case of brad nailers, the 18-gauge variant is celebrated for its versatility. It strikes a balance between the sturdiness of thicker gauges and the finesse of thinner ones, making it suitable for a wide array of applications.

  2. Ideal for Trim Work: The 18-gauge pneumatic brad nailer excels in trim work, where precision and a clean finish are paramount. Its slender profile minimizes the risk of splitting delicate trim pieces, ensuring a professional outcome.

Pneumatic Power: Unleashing Efficiency

The Dynamics of Pneumatic Operation

  1. Compressed Air Mastery: Pneumatic brad nailers, including the 18-gauge variant, rely on compressed air for operation. This design ensures rapid firing, allowing contractors to work efficiently without compromising on the power needed to drive nails into various materials.

  2. Consistency in Performance: Unlike battery-operated counterparts, pneumatic nailers maintain consistent power throughout the project. Contractors can rely on a steady stream of compressed air to drive nails accurately, whether it’s for trim installation or cabinet assembly.

Technical Features: The Anatomy of Precision

Breaking Down the Components

  1. Adjustable Depth Control: Precision is not a one-size-fits-all concept. The 18-gauge pneumatic brad nailer offers adjustable depth control, allowing contractors to customize the depth of the nail according to the project requirements.

  2. Magazine Capacity: Efficiency often hinges on the capacity of the nail magazine. The 18-gauge pneumatic brad nailer typically boasts a magazine that can hold a substantial number of nails, minimizing the need for frequent reloading.

  3. Sequential Firing Mode: Tailoring the tool to the task is simplified with the sequential firing mode. Contractors can choose between single-shot and rapid-fire modes, ensuring flexibility and control in various applications.

Practical Applications: From Trim to Finishing

Nailing It Right in Different Scenarios

  1. Trim Installation: The finesse of the 18-gauge brad nailer shines in trim installation. Its slender nails and precise firing make it ideal for attaching trim pieces without causing damage.

  2. Cabinet Assembly: When it comes to assembling cabinets, the 18-gauge pneumatic brad nailer offers the perfect balance of strength and delicacy. It secures pieces together with accuracy, contributing to the overall durability of the assembly.
